Orion product. Your new TeleTrack AZ-G Altazimuth GoTo Mount allows high performance support for terrestrial or astronomical observations. The TeleTrack AZ-G is an “altazimuth” type of mount which can move in both altitude (up and down) and azimuth (left and right) with respect to the ground.
